What is the best amp for Sonus Faber Cremonas?


I currently am driving the Cremonas with a Mac MC402. I find the Mac amp to be too dark with too much bass. (The speakers are well positioned out into the room.) I recently auditioned an Accuphase A-30 class A amp compared to a pair of Mac MC501's with Wilson Sophias and thought the Accuphase was far more musical and detailed. I never would have thought a 30 watt amp into 8 ohm (60 watts into 4 ohms) would be so effective. I am concerned about using this amp in my room which is 25' x 20'. My speakers have an impedence of 4 ohm with a sensitivity of 90db. I am using a the Mac C2200 tube preamp, but I would be willing to switch it out as well.

If I had to live with solid state it would either be Pass Labs or McCormack. The Sonus Faberline of speakers are kinda picky when it comes to finding a good match in an amplifier. McIntosh is a great product - but probably not a good match for your speakers. Before you get rid of the McIntosh - just be very sure that your preamp is not the culprit.
